Beitar Jerusalem beat Hapoel Tel Aviv 0:1 this evening (Monday) in a match held at Bloomfield Stadium. The match itself was uneventful, but it turns out that a big drama took place before it.
The Israel Police announced this evening that even before the game, Ayalon area police officers managed to seize a large amount of pyrotechnic devices that could cause injury to the body and mind.
When some of the measures were caught in shoes and in low places.
The seized devices include 18 naval flares and fireworks and 2 smoke grenades.
As a result, 11 suspects were arrested.
In the photos published by the police, it can be seen that some of the seized means are standard military equipment that made its way from the IDF warehouses to the field.
The Israel Police stated: "The Israel Police will act with zero tolerance towards any manifestation of violence and risk to life, we will act hard with the law breakers and will exhaust the law with them to the end."
It should be noted that despite the many efforts, a number of flares were lit in the Bloomfield stands this evening, but were thrown onto the field.
